So in the seventh book we know that either Harry or Voldermort are going to kick the bucket. But which one. What if halfway through the book Harry murders Voldermort. What if thinking he is all powerfull takes Voldermort's position as Dark Lord. What if Harry Potter does an Anakin Skywalker. Over the course of books 3, 4, 5, and 6 we have explored deeply into Harry's darker nature. He's started to use Unforgivable Curses so what if he entirely snapped??? I'm not saying it is going to happen.....but it could.

I have thought it would be interesting if one of the characters that is well trusted turned evil. Not an evil all along type story, but was actually seduced by the dark side. I kind of thought that was where the Percy subplot was going when he abandoned his family and agreed that Voldemort wasn't back, but that whole family tragedy bit was practically dropped in the last book.
